TMH, Bixler Emergency Center

*Located at Tallahassee Memorial Healthcare Hospital *Treats all types of emergencies *Trauma center, comprehensive stroke center, chest pain center, head and back injuries, trouble breathing *Severe allergic reaction, major burns and cuts, loss of consciousness, fever over 102 with severe headache, trouble breathing or faintness *Pregnancy contractions, poisoning, and other major emergency health concerns *Minor health problems often treated more quickly at the TMH Urgent Care Center, 1541 Medical Dr, 32308, call ahead 850-431-7816

Services: Emergency Room Care, Hospitals

The Learning Pavilion

*Formerly Dick Howser Center for Childhood Services *Programs for children ages 6 weeks to 6 years *Early intervention and therapies for children exhibiting development delays or disabilities, including speech, physical, occupational therapy, and music therapy *Early childhood education, school readiness VPK, and summer programs *Early Creative Curriculum emphasizes the role of the child, the teacher (or caregiver), the family and the community

Services: Child Care Centers, Early Intervention for Children With Disabilities/Delays, Preschools, Summer School Programs

TCC, Dental Hygiene Clinic

*Students in the dental hygiene program prepare for licensure as registered dental hygienist *Provide dental screenings, x-rays, and cleanings to the general public at reduced rates *No restorative or surgical procedures *Students from any educational facility of any age are eligible for the student discount

Services: Colleges/Universities, Dental Care

Taylor County Recovery Center, Inc.

*DCF licensed out-patient substance abuse treatment program for ages 13 and over including adults; individual and group counseling, substance abuse education, treatment planning and review, discharge planning, relapse prevention, probation reporting *Other DCF licensed classes open to anyone in the community: parenting classes, dealing with trauma, co-dependency, employability skills training, money management, HIV/AIDS education, domestic violence, batterer's intervention, anger management, conflict resolution, Drivers' License Assistance Classes for Driving while License Suspended/Revoked (DWLS/R) *Can be self-referred or ordered by the court system for any services offered *DCF ACCESS Community Partner Site: anyone may make an appointment to go there to apply for Medicaid, Food Stamps/SNAP and/or TANF

Services: AIDS/HIV Prevention Counseling, Anger Management, Comprehensive Outpatient Substance Use Disorder Treatment, Employment Preparation, Food Stamps/SNAP, Medicaid, Parenting Skills Classes, Spouse/Intimate Partner Abuse Counseling, TANF

Tallahassee Lions Club

*Service club that collects, recycles, and donates eyeglasses and hearing aids for those in need *Other services: testing and help for macular degeneration, cataract surgery, dogs for visually impaired persons, dogs for hearing impaired persons, and eye and tissue banks *Collects used printer cartridges, collects old cell phones, sells broom and mops to fund services *Lunch meetings held at Elks Lodge, 276 Magnolia Dr, Tallahassee

Services: Donated Specialty Items, Hearing Augmentation Aids, Service Clubs, Visual/Reading Aids

Stork's Nest, The

*Distribution center where low income pregnant women can get up to $60 in E-gift cards by participating in prenatal classes *There are 6 total online training modules; participating women will earn $10 per completed module *Additionally, women may choose to continue with the program for up to a year and earn things like car seats, disposable diapers, sleeper gowns, booties/socks, baby wipes, receiving blankets, undershirts, onesies, bottles/nipples, outer garment, wash clothes, and towels *Volunteer group, office not open every day; call, may need to leave message

Services: Baby Clothing, Childbirth Education, Expectant/New Parent Assistance, Parenting Skills Classes
